Understanding the Umrah Visa Process for UK Citizens
For UK citizens planning an Umrah, understanding the visa process is essential. The first step involves confirming eligibility and gathering necessary documents, such as a valid passport with at least six months’ validity from the date of entry into Saudi Arabia, recent passport-size photographs, and proof of financial stability. Once these are in place, applicants can begin the online application for the Umrah visa through the official Saudi Arabian government website.
The Umrah Visa fee for UK citizens is typically around £43 (or equivalent), although this may vary based on the type of visa and additional services chosen. After submitting the application, individuals will usually receive their visa within a few business days. It’s important to remember that the process can be fast-tracked for those who require a quicker turnaround time at an additional cost.

Step-by-Step Guide to Obtaining Your Umrah Visa from the UK
Obtaining an Umrah visa from the UK involves several steps and careful preparation. First, ensure your passport is valid for at least six months beyond your intended stay in Saudi Arabia. Next, gather essential documents such as proof of employment, bank statements, and a letter of invitation from a Saudi host or travel agent. These documents are crucial for demonstrating financial capability and the purpose of your visit.
Once you have these ready, apply online through the official Saudi Arabian government website. Fill out the application form accurately, providing detailed information about your trip. Pay the Umrah Visa fee from the UK, which varies based on your nationality and the type of visa required. After submission, track your application’s status and prepare for any further requests or documentation needed.

Important Documents Required for UK Umrah Visa Application
When applying for an Umrah visa from the UK, there are several important documents that you’ll need to provide. These include a valid passport with at least 6 months remaining from the date of entry into Saudi Arabia, recent passport-sized photographs, and a completed visa application form. It’s also crucial to have proof of financial means to cover your stay, such as bank statements or cash equivalents.
Additionally, you’ll require a fit-to-travel certificate, confirming that you’re in good health and free from any infectious diseases. Other essential documents include confirmation of your Umrah tour package details, accommodation bookings, and travel insurance covering medical emergencies and repatriation. Ensure all these documents are up-to-date and relevant to avoid delays in the visa application process, as the UK Umrah Visa fee is non-refundable.
